The takeover offer for Musgrave Minerals Ltd (ASX:MGV, OTC:MGVMF) has been declared unconditional and free of all defeating conditions with Ramelius Resources taking its relevant interest in the gold explorer to 47.36%.
Ramelius says the offer, which is open until 7.00pm (Sydney time) on Friday, September 15, 2023, is its best and final offer and will not be increased unless there is a competing proposal.
Given its current relevant interest in Musgrave, Ramelius believes it is unlikely that a superior proposal will eventuate.

Musgrave's directors have unanimously recommended that shareholders accept the Ramelius offer in the absence of a superior proposal and have already accepted into the offer.
Ramelius dividend
An incentive for remaining Musgrave shareholders to accept the offer is that those who accept by the record date of September 15, 2023, will be eligible to receive a fully franked dividend of 2.0 cents per Ramelius share held.
Ramelius has made an off-market offer to acquire all of the Musgrave ordinary shares at a rate of 1 Ramelius share for every 4.21 Musgrave shares plus $0.04 cash per Musgrave share in accordance with a bidder’s statement dated July 11, 2023, and supplementary bidder’s statement dated August 11, 2023.

The offer consideration from Ramelius will be accelerated so that it is provided within 10 business days.
Musgrave shareholders who have already validly accepted the offer will be provided with their consideration within 10 business days and those who have yet to accept the offer will also be provided with their consideration within 10 business days of acceptance.
